Barron Collier and Immokalee are an even 5-5 against one another since January of 2017, but not for long. The Barron Collier Cougars will welcome the Immokalee Indians at 7:30 p.m. on Thursday. Barron Collier will be strutting in after a win while Immokalee will be coming in after a loss.
Barron Collier took a loss when they played away from home last Monday, but their home fans gave them all the motivation they needed on Tuesday. They took down Golden Gate 63-47. Given the Cougars' advantage in MaxPreps' Florida basketball rankings (they are ranked 175th, while the Titans are ranked 471st), the result wasn't entirely unexpected.
Meanwhile, Immokalee came up short against Naples on Tuesday and fell 62-51.
Barron Collier will need focus on slowing down Gilbert Charles, one of several Immokalee players who made an impact when they last played. He posted 12 points and three steals. Timarian Howard was another key player, dropping a double-double on ten points and 11 rebounds.
Barron Collier pushed their record up to 12-4 with the victory, which was their 15th straight at home dating back to last season. The wins came thanks to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they averaged 64.3 points per game. As for Immokalee, their defeat dropped their record down to 7-6.
